Description
Magnesia-carbon brick is a kind of non-burning carbon composite refractory material made from high-melting-point basic oxide magnesia and high-melting-point graphite, which is resistant to slag penetration,adding various non-oxide additives and combining with carbonaceous binder. As a composite refractory material, magnesia carbon bricks effectively combine the strong slag resistance of magnesia with the high thermal conductivity and low thermal expansion of carbon, thereby compensating for magnesia’s poor spalling resistance. Their main features include excellent high-temperature performance, strong slag resistance, good thermal shock resistance, and low high-temperature creep.

Applications
Mainly used in the metallurgical industry, such as converters, AC electric arc furnaces, DC electric arc furnaces, ladles, hot metal ladles, and torpedo cars.
